Nicholas FoxClass of 2026

Nicholas Fox is from the South Side of Chicago, IL and a 2017 graduate of Butler University with a B.S in Risk Management/Insurance and Minor in Pre-Law. Prior to being accepted to the Georgetown University Law Center, he reached the rank of Vice President at Marsh & McLennan’s Cyber Center of Excellence, in his hometown. He has held multiple positions at Marsh, from consultant to broker, and serves as the CEO of his own streetwear brand, Gratitude Chicago, LLC. As a consultant he worked specifically in the Emerging Risks Practice and assisted clients in understanding/mitigating the effects of emerging risks stemming from cyber, geopolitical, climate, terrorism, etc. to their balance sheet. As a broker, he focused on advising clients on how to create more polished cyber security plans and with purchasing adequate cyber/technology errors and omission policies. He has a passion for problem solving and giving back to his community. His company, Gratitude Chicago, LLC, is a streetwear brand that prides itself on emphasizing the importance of showing gratitude in your everyday life. While he and his co-founders operate an e-commerce platform, and wholesale to Foot Locker, Inc. locations in six different states, they have more importantly started four different scholarships and helped fund one of the first STEM education centers on the South Side of Chicago, designed to give back to minority students from disenfranchised communities. In addition to these scholarships, Nick has teamed up with two of his fellow Butler classmates to start their own endowed scholarship in an attempt to increase the number of African American males who matriculate through the University. Nick has a passion for Intellectual Property and has successfully filed his own trademarks for both his own business and as the operations manager for his father’s business. His ultimate goal is to combine his passion for art, sports, and intellectual property and work for a large law firm specializing in issues in these areas.
